Related: About this forumDemocrat Mark R. Herring is in a near dead heat, poll finds
Republican Mark D. Obenshain and Democrat Mark R. Herring are in a near dead heat to become Virginias top lawyer. Herring, a state senator from Loudoun County, has the support of 49 percent of respondents, while Obenshain, a senator from Harrisonburg, gets 46 percent. The race is within the polls margin of error.
